
The St Louis-San Francisco railroad cuts a diagonal path through Mississippi County, anchoring a landscape defined by its complex relationship with the Mississippi River. This mid-century survey reveals an intricate network of drainage ditches and levees protecting established river towns like Wilson and Joiner. The presence of the Golden Lake Crevasse near the Arkansas River border serves as a reminder of the region's alluvial volatility.
